码迷,mamicode.com
首页 >  
搜索关键字:自增    ( 3325个结果
Yii2.0自增主键查询老是字符串的原因剖析
【项目背景】 最近在做一个restful风格的项目,发现有个表返回的json数据中id始终是string类型,但另一个表的id始终是int类型。即返回的数据类型不一致。 【原因剖析】 在yii\db\Schema类的getColumnPhpType函数中,这个函数决定了最终出来的数据的类型,代码如下 ...
分类:其他好文   时间:2020-02-08 13:42:21    阅读次数:75
【java-27-28】java语言基础-算术运算符&赋值运算符
一、算术运算符: 1)+ - * / % + 应用: 2) ++(自增) 二、赋值运算符 = += -= *= /= %= 自动做强转 ...
分类:编程语言   时间:2020-02-08 00:35:13    阅读次数:72
MySql数据完整性
MySql数据完整性 一、什么是数据完整性? 数据完整性是指数据库中数据在逻辑上的一致性、正确性、有效性和相容性。 1、域(列)完整性 通过对数据的类型、数据的长度、数据的范围进行约束来保证猎德完整性 2、实体(行)完整性 不能有重复的行,不能有不满足要求的行 3、引用完整性 当有主外键关系时,外键 ...
分类:数据库   时间:2020-02-07 12:41:49    阅读次数:112
Java 中的运算符和流程控制
Java 中的运算符和流程控制 + 面试题 算术运算符 Java 中的算术运算符,包括以下几种: 算术运算符 名称 举例 + 加法 1+2=3 减法 2 1=1 \ 乘法 2\ 3=6 / 除法 24/8=3 % 求余 24%7=3 ++ 自增1 int i=1;i++ 自减1 int i=1;i ...
分类:编程语言   时间:2020-02-06 10:40:39    阅读次数:68
在分布式场景,生成唯一ID
在分布式环境下生成数据库主键是一件比较麻烦的事情,这里简单总结下,以供以后使用。 数据库自增长序列或字段 每个服务器使用自增主键,不同服务器的步长不一样,比如 A 服务器生成 B 服务器生成 。 缺点:难以扩展。合并数据库时非常麻烦。分库分表时难以处理。 UUID 常见的方式。可以利用数据库也可以利 ...
分类:其他好文   时间:2020-02-05 18:10:03    阅读次数:62
大事务造成的延迟(从binlog入手分析)
log_event.cc 入口: int Query_log_event::do_apply_event(Relay_log_info const *rli,const char *query_arg, size_t q_len_arg) 包括: sql_mode , 客户端字符集,自增环境设置,登 ...
分类:其他好文   时间:2020-02-03 20:46:03    阅读次数:98
mybatis plus 自己用了框架的自增id问题
暂时不知道是什么原因,自己用过很多次mybatisplus,有的不会出现这个问题。 原因肯定是mybatisplus用了框架自身的id增长机制,但是不知道怎么控制,所以归根结底还是对框架不熟悉吧。 解决办法就是关掉mybatis自增长,在实体映射类里更改相关注解即可: @TableId(value ...
分类:其他好文   时间:2020-02-02 19:56:29    阅读次数:329
MyBatis中id回填的两种方式
在一种场景下需要刚刚插入数据的ID,如果数据少可以先看数据库,记下ID,但数据很多,假设一万个用户并发,每个用户都插入自己的ID,就很难记下来。 下面给定一个场景: 1 User user = new User("张三","123456",new Date());//此时user没有id 2 use ...
分类:其他好文   时间:2020-02-02 16:14:32    阅读次数:130
MySQL自增id不连续问题
项目中有一张表是记录人员,在每个新用户调用接口认证通过了之后,会有一个往该表插入这个新用户信息的操作。 但是在线上环境中,发现该表的自增id不连续,且间隔都是差了2,比如上一个人的id是10,下一个人的id就是12,而在前端页面中,一个用户认证通过后,会调用3个接口,初步排查是MySQL并发操作导致 ...
分类:数据库   时间:2020-02-01 16:00:10    阅读次数:166
035、Java中自增之++在后面的写法
01.代码如下: package TIANPAN; /** * 此处为文档注释 * * @author 田攀 微信382477247 */ public class TestDemo { public static void main(String[] args) { int numA = 10; ...
分类:编程语言   时间:2020-02-01 14:46:37    阅读次数:94
3325条   上一页 1 ... 34 35 36 37 38 ... 333 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!